What is Prezcobix ®?

PREZCOBIX ® is a prescription medicine that is used with other HIV-1 medicines to treat HIV-1 infection in adults and in children who weigh at least 88 pounds (40 kg). HIV-1 is the virus that causes Acquired Immune Deficiency Syndrome (AIDS).

What should I monitor when taking Prezcobix® (cobicistat)?

Sulfa Allergy: Monitor patients with a known sulfonamide allergy after initiating PREZCOBIX ® . Effects on Serum Creatinine: Cobicistat decreases estimated creatinine clearance (CrCl) due to inhibition of tubular secretion of creatinine without affecting actual renal glomerular function.

Is there a generic for Prezcobix?

No. There is currently no therapeutically equivalent version of Prezcobix available in the United States. Note: Fraudulent online pharmacies may attempt to sell an illegal generic version of Prezcobix. These medications may be counterfeit and potentially unsafe.

Can Prezcobix be crushed?

Darunavir + Cobicistat Prezcobix Rezolsta Tablets should be swallowed whole to ensure administration of the entire dose of both darunavir and cobicistat. Crushing of tablets is not recommended in the product information.

Can Biktarvy and PREZCOBIX be taken together?

Using cobicistat together with tenofovir can increase the effects of tenofovir, which can cause new or worse kidney problems. You may need a dose adjustment or more frequent monitoring by your doctor to safely use both medications. Contact your doctor if your condition changes or you experience increased side effects.

What class is darunavir?

Darunavir is in a class of medications called protease inhibitors. It works by decreasing the amount of HIV in the blood.

Can you take Prezcobix while pregnant?

It is not known if PREZCOBIX ® will harm your unborn baby. PREZCOBIX ® should not be used during pregnancy because the PREZCOBIX ® levels in your blood may be lower during pregnancy and may not control your HIV-1. Tell your healthcare provider right away if you become pregnant during treatment with PREZCOBIX ®.

Can you breastfeed with prezcobix?

are breastfeeding, or plan to breastfeed. You should not breastfeed if you have HIV-1 because of the risk of passing HIV-1 to your baby. It is not known if PREZCOBIX ® can pass into your breast milk.

Can Prezcobix cause rash?

PREZCOBIX® may cause severe or life-threatening skin reactions or rashes . Stop taking PREZCOBIX® and call your healthcare provider right away if you develop any skin changes with symptoms below: Fever. Tiredness. Muscle or joint pain. Blisters or skin lesions. Mouth sores or ulcers.

What is prezcobix used for?

PREZCOBIX ® is indicated in combination with other antiretroviral agents for the treatment of human immunodeficiency virus (HIV-1) infection in treatment-naïve and treatment-experienced adults and pediatric patients weighing at least 40 kg with no darunavir resistance-associated substitutions (V11I, V32I, L33F, I47V, I50V, I54L, I54M, T74P, L76V, I84V, L89V).

Can you do laboratory testing before taking Prezcobix?

Appropriate laboratory testing should be conducted prior to initiating and during therapy with PREZCOBIX ®. Evidence of new or worsening liver dysfunction in patients on PREZCOBIX ® should prompt consideration of interruption or discontinuation of treatment.

Is Prezcobix safe for pregnancy?

PREZCOBIX ® is not recommended for use during pregnancy because of substantially lower exposures of darunavir and cobicistat during pregnancy.

Can you take Prezcobix with other drugs?

Antiretrovirals Not Recommended: Do not use PREZCOBIX ® in combination with other antiret roviral drugs that require pharmacokinetic boosting or which contain the individual components of PREZCOBIX ® (darunavir and cobicistat) or with ritonavir.

Does cobicistat affect creatinine?

Effects on Serum Creatinine: Cobicistat decreases estimated creatinine clear ance (CrCl) due to inhibition of tubular secretion of creatinine without affecting actual renal glomerular function. Prior to starting PREZCOBIX ®, assess estimated CrCl. Patients who experience a confirmed increase in serum creatinine of greater than 0.4 mg/dL from baseline should be closely monitored for renal safety. Consider alternative medications that do not require dosage adjustments in patients with renal impairment.

Is Prezcobix safe for children?

The safety and effectiveness of PREZCOBIX ® have not been established and is not recommended in pediatric patients weighing less than 40 kg.

What is Prezcobix?

Prezcobix contains a combination of the prescription medicines darunavir and cobicistat. Darunavir is classed as an antiviral medicine that helps to stop human immunodeficiency virus (HIV) from replicating in your body. Cobicistat blocks the action of certain enzymes in your liver that break down the antiviral medicines. This allows the antiviral medicines to be more effective and used more safely at lower doses.

What is the function of cobicistat?

Cobicistat blocks the action of a chemical in the body called cytochrome P450. Cytochrome P450 is an enzyme involved in the breakdown of many medicines, including darunavir. Blocking this action of the enzyme allows the medicine, in this case darunavir, to carry out its activities more effectively.
